两手空空
liǎng shǒu kōng kōng
What 两手空空 means
- empty-handed (idiom); fig. not receiving anything
The characters in 两手空空
- 两liǎngtwo; both; some
- 手shǒuhand; (formal) to hold; person engaged in certain types of work
- 空kōngempty; air; sky
